Understanding CLI in Peripheral Arterial Disease
What is Critical Limb Ischemia (CLI)?
Critical Limb Ischemia is an advanced stage of PAD characterized by severe obstruction of the arteries, leading to reduced blood flow to the limbs. This condition can result in pain, ulcers, and, in the worst cases, tissue loss and gangrene.
Link Between CLI and Peripheral Arterial Disease
CLI is often considered a complication of PAD. It typically occurs in individuals with long-standing, untreated PAD, where the blood flow to the limbs is critically impaired.
Symptoms and Consequences of CLI
The symptoms of CLI can include severe pain at rest, non-healing ulcers, and a high risk of limb amputation. The consequences are not only physical but also emotional, impacting the overall quality of life for patients.
Conventional Treatment vs. Stem Cell Therapies
Current Standard Treatments for CLI
Conventional treatments for CLI involve medications, lifestyle changes, and, in some cases, surgical interventions such as angioplasty or bypass surgery.
Limitations of Conventional Approaches
While these treatments can provide relief, they often fall short in cases of severe CLI, where amputation becomes a looming possibility. Moreover, conventional treatments do not address the root cause of the problem.

How Stem Cell Therapies Work
Stem cell therapies operate on a fascinating principle – harnessing the body’s natural healing power at its most fundamental level. These therapies begin by isolating specific types of stem cells, often from a patient’s own body, such as bone marrow or adipose tissue. Alternatively, stem cells can be derived from external sources, like umbilical cord blood. Once harvested, these versatile cells are carefully cultivated and then reintroduced into the patient’s body, targeting the affected area. These transplanted stem cells act as cellular repair crews, differentiating into the required cell types and promoting tissue regeneration.
